Test Automation Engineer
As Test Automation Engineer, you will work in tandem with the software development team to validate, document, test, and deploy applications making a positive impact on millions of Americans' daily lives. You’ll work with various teams, contractors and clients to ensure that our work is scalable, deployable and of the highest quality (no pun intended…). Â
What you’ll be doing:
- Provide technical guidance and expertise to team members and/or colleagues.
- Work with Software Engineers, System Engineers, and DevOps Engineers in the correction of any defects found.
- Guide and implement strategies to help engineering and leadership make quick and decisive decisions.
- Build and implement test reports, communicating the results to multiple stakeholders.
- Make decisions based on strategy and context, and roll out changes as needed to boost efficiency.
- 3+ years experience working with growing, technically minded companies.
- Bachelor's Degree.
- Experience delivering test scripts, test cases and test plans that are in alignment with Business-Driven Development/Test Driven Development (BDD/TDD) using tools such as (Selenium/Web Driver, Cucumber, Geb, Spock, SOAP UI, Postman).
- Ability to apply appropriate test methodologies, including writing test plans and test cases.
- Knowledge of at least one development language, including Java, C++, C#, or Groovy.
- Experience with test methodologies, QA process, software release cycle, test effort estimation, and tracking.
- Knowledge of Software Development Life Cycle (SDLC).Â
- Knowledge of Agile, Scrum, and SAFe.